Evaporation & heating costs

Evaporation is the biggest Heat thieves.

Most of the energy is lost through the open water surface: evaporation alone accounts for around 70 per cent of total heat loss from a pool. Every litre that evaporates carries heat away – and must be replaced by adding more hot water and topping up the pool.

A tight-fitting cover prevents exactly that. It keeps heat, water and chemicals in the pool – day and night. This significantly reduces heating costs and extends the swimming season by weeks.

up to
−50 %
lower heating costs per season
up to
−70 %
less evaporation & water loss

All figures are estimates provided for guidance only – the actual figures depend on the pool, its location and how it is used.

Where does the heat from an open-air swimming pool go?
Evaporationapprox. 70%
Radiation & Convectionapprox. 20%
Pool walls & floorapprox. 10%

This is exactly where the cover comes in: it seals the water’s surface and eliminates by far the biggest source of heat loss.

Guideline values according to the Fraunhofer Institute for Building Physics (EDA-F 2.02) – the exact values depend on the pool, its location and how it is used.

Design Cover PC – the polycarbonate pool cover in detail

The Design Cover PC is the premium slatted pool cover from Rollo Solar, made of solid polycarbonate. It combines high safety, noticeable heat retention and a design that enhances the pool instead of hiding it. Every profile is manufactured to size at our factory in Bad Tölz.

Why polycarbonate?

Polycarbonate is far more impact resistant and dimensionally stable than simple PVC profiles. The Design Cover PC bears point loads of up to 100 kg, is TÜV tested and certified to hail class 3. The profiles use a 4-chamber hollow design whose enclosed air chambers provide buoyancy and good thermal insulation.

Safety you can see

With a load capacity of up to 100 kg, the Design Cover PC reliably prevents children or pets from falling into the water unnoticed. Hail class 3 and the TÜV certification show that the profile withstands wind, weather and hail season after season.

Store heat, save energy

The profile floats directly on the water surface. During the day the solar colour variants absorb the energy of the sun and release it into the water, so the pool gets warmer without additional heating. At night the cover reduces evaporation and keeps the heat in the pool – lower heating costs, less water loss and less chemistry.

Frequently asked questions about the Design Cover PC

Can you walk on the Design Cover PC?

The profile is a safety cover with a load capacity of up to 100 kg and prevents children and animals from falling in. It is not a surface intended for walking, so do not step on it on purpose.

What is the difference between the PC and PVC cover?

The polycarbonate PC profile is more impact resistant, more durable and available in metallic finishes. The Design Cover PVC is the robust, more affordable option. See the cover comparison.

Does the cover withstand hail?

Yes, the Design Cover PC is certified to hail class 3.

What warranty is included?

We grant a 5-year warranty on the profile.
